Abstract

The utility model discloses a compaction device, which comprises a base (1), wherein a central rod (2) is vertically arranged in the center of the base (1), and a compaction part (3) is sleeved at the lower end of the central rod (2); the upper end of the central rod (2) is provided with a traction piece (4), and the traction piece (4) is used for pulling the tamping piece (3) to move up and down along the central rod (2). Background technology
In the continuous exploitation in mine, cause the ecological environment in colliery, stone pit and metal and nonmetal deposits mountain poor, open The barren rock stockyard formed during adopting and refuse dump, owing to destroying original Soil structure, create the loose of many accumulations Garbage, causes rock-mass relaxing, loose garbage to pile up instability, and mining area breaking topography phenomenon is serious, and avalanche easily occurs With natural disasters such as landslides;Also can produce substantial amounts of soil erosion, cause vegetation deterioration, water body and heavy metal pollution.
Barren rock stockyard and refuse dump loose media size differ, and loose media platform is layered by transport dregs vehicle Tamp, cause its soil layer construction unreasonable, bad hydraulic permeability, it is unfavorable for plant growing.Under soil compression, ventilating slit can be caused Degree reduces, defective aeration, increases soil volume quality, reduces soil permeability, and these impacts are growth and development of plants Unfavorable factor.Compacted soil makes resistance of soil and mechanical resistance substantially increase, and the supply of oxygen and water-holding capacity reduce, plant photosynthesis speed Rate declines, and these factors cause pricking under root system of plant being obstructed.Research is how under the conditions of different-grain diameter and different number of machine passes etc. Soil function and application the Different Ways of Planting impact on plant growing, finally determine the Soil structure of optimum plant growing And compaction process, the compaction test research carrying out incompact-deposit bodies is particularly important.
Hit the real equipment Indoor Impaction Test mainly for roadbed material at present, measure compacting soil optimum moisture content and Its bulk density, as building roadbed and the basis controlling soil moisture and appointment least density when banketing.Not for Mine Abandoned Land incompact-deposit bodies carries out compaction test and the research of plant growing impact effect, be not suitable for big particle diameter (< The mensuration of the Compaction after gangue materials 50mm) and mixing with soil.

This utility model is applicable to the compacting after the incompact-deposit bodies material of particle diameter (< 50mm) and mixing with soil.Use not The water content of same compactive effort (hammer weigh × falls away from × hammer number) hammering difference sample respectively.Compaction cylinder external diameter 32.3cm, week Long 101.5cm, internal diameter 31cm, highly 32cm, weight is 22.6kg.Cake quality is 2kg, diameter 10cm, highly 5cm.Drain Length of tube 5cm, internal diameter 7mm.Center-pole starts from bottom to measure, and has the scale value of 50cm, each pull bar that cake is pulled to 50cm During place, it is further added by the number of times of hammering, calculates the compactive effort every time testing gained.
